Friday 5 June 2015

Oats Royd

12:30 - 14:30

I was deciding my walk area this morning, when I heard a couple of calls from a Cuckoo, coming from Oats Royd area, so that made the decision for me.

It was a hot and sunny morning with cloud and breeze coming along later.

It was just the usual stuff about today.

The pr. Canada Goose and 6 large Gosling were feeding in the farm fields near Bradshaw Park.

Down by the ponds and nearby:-

3 Willow Warbler, 4 Chiffchaff, Pr. Canada and the 3 domesticated.
9 Swallow, 2 Moorhen and 1 very skittish Moorhen chick on the top pond.

6 Chaffinch, 2 Pied Wagtail, 1 Meadow Pipit, 2 House Sparrow, 7 Greenfinch, 1 Goldcrest in the pines near the factory at Holdsworth.
2 Goldfinch, 5 Dunnock, 2 Collard Dove, 2 Robin, Poss. Whitethroat in the Bradshaw Park hedge.
A large gull over poss LBBG but pic. poor


No sight or sound of the Cuckoo.
